Welcome to the Rogues Harbor Inn—an 1830s National Historic Landmark nestled just 10 minutes from downtown Ithaca, Cornell University, and the Cayuga Wine Trail. This meticulously preserved and tastefully updated three-story brick building offers a dynamic blend of commercial and hospitality income potential, perfect for investors,entrepreneurs, or those seeking a lifestyle business in one of upstate New York’s most scenic and thriving areas. The property features a well-established nine-room Bed & Breakfast with thoughtfully curated guest accommodations, each offering private baths, air conditioning, Wi-Fi, and period-specific charm. The third-floor ballroom serves as a stunning breakfast area, with original architectural details that wow guests daily.
Anchoring the ground level is The Corner Pub, a beloved neighborhood bar and restaurant with a strong local following and glowing reputation. With a full commercial kitchen, rustic oak bar, exposed brick, and seating for both casual diners and larger events, this space is built to serve—from intimate meals to high-volume weekends.
